Payments Lead – Everyday Banking (Debit), Advisors & Consulting Services (12 months)

Overview
We are seeking a dynamic and experienced Payments Lead with Issuing experience to join the Everyday Banking (Debit) team within one of our key banking partners. In this fixed term 12 month contract, you will have the opportunity to shape the future of our debit products and make a significant impact on our customers' banking experience. Hybrid work is applicable to this position.

Role
As a Payments Lead, you will oversee priority engagements within the debit segment, driving product development, managing operations, and ensuring compliance with industry standards. Your key responsibilities will include:
•\tProduct Development: Lead the development and enhancement of debit card products, ensuring they align with customer needs and market trends.
•\tProject Management: Oversee priority projects within the debit segment, ensuring timely delivery and alignment with strategic objectives.
•\tStakeholder Collaboration: Work closely with cross-functional teams, including marketing, IT, and compliance, to ensure cohesive product strategies and implementations.
•\tMarket Analysis: Conduct regular market research to identify opportunities for product innovation and improvement.
•\tRegulatory Compliance: Ensure all debit products and processes comply with relevant regulations and industry standards.
•\tVendor Management: Manage relationships with external partners and vendors to support product development and operational efficiency.
•\tPerformance Monitoring: Track and analyse product performance metrics, implementing improvements as necessary to meet business goals.

All About You
To be successful in this role, you should have:
•\tEducation: Bachelor's degree in Business, Finance, or a related field.
•\tExperience: Minimum of 5 years in product management or a related role within the payments industry (Issuing), with a focus on debit card products. Experience working with DXC Technologies, Connex, Payment scheme Technologies.
•\tSkills:
o\tSolid experience as a payments professional in technical product management.
o\tDemonstrated in-depth understanding of Card payments / Merchant Acquiring / Payments Technology / clearing and settlements.
o\tBe willing to get your hands dirty – from writing Jira stories, leading investigations, drawing swim lane diagrams to running sprint meetings.
o\tStrong understanding of the payments and Issuing landscape, particularly debit card products.
o\tProven project management skills with the ability to lead cross-functional teams.
o\tExcellent technical, analytical and problem-solving abilities.
o\tEffective communication and interpersonal skills.
o\tProficiency in relevant software and tools.
